The Palestinian Resistance in Gaza continues to target Israeli forces and their vehicles with shells, explosives, rockets, and sniper attacks, documenting the operations.

The Palestinian Resistance in the Gaza Strip continues to target the Israeli occupation forces on various combat fronts, inflicting confirmed losses on the occupation as part of Operation Al-Aqsa Flood. 

Al-Qassam Brigades - the military wing of Hamas - detailed that the fighters targeted an Israeli troop carrier with an Al Yassin 105 shell near the Tamraz station in the middle of the Jabalia camp in the northern Gaza Strip. 

The Brigades also targeted two Israeli Merkava 4 tanks with an Al Yassin 105 shell and a Shawaz explosive device at the al-Radhi junction in the center of Beit Lahia city, north of the Gaza Strip. 

The battalions similarly targeted an Israeli Merkava 4 tank with a Shawaz explosive device in the vicinity of al-Tawbah Mosque, west of Jabalia camp, in the northern Gaza Strip.

In turn, the al-Quds Brigades - the military wing of the Islamic Jihad Movement - managed to snipe an Israeli soldier near the energy area east of Gaza City.

The brigades targeted positions of the Israeli occupation, using mortar shells, on the supply line in the Netzarim axis.

At the same time, the Brigades bombed with regular mortar shells (60 mm caliber) the gatherings of Israeli occupation soldiers and their vehicles that had infiltrated the vicinity of the Bourj Awad intersection in the al-Janina neighborhood, east of the city of Rafah, in the southern Gaza Strip.

As for the al-Aqsa Martyrs Brigades, it announced that it had fired two short-range 107 missiles at gatherings of occupation soldiers and their vehicles stationed around the Rafah land crossing in the southern Gaza Strip.

The resistance documents its operations

As part of its operations, the al-Aqsa Brigades documented the bombing of an occupation command and control headquarters in the Netzarim axis with heavy mortar shells. 

The Mujahideen Brigades also documented their operation, in cooperation with the al-Quds Brigades, of the occupation forces in the Fajjah military site and the Netzarim axis.

On Tuesday, Al Mayadeen's correspondent in Gaza reported that the Resistance engaged in fierce confrontations with the occupation forces in the al-Jenena neighborhood, east of the city of Rafah in the southern Gaza Strip.

The al-Qassam Brigades announced that its fighters had managed to snipe at an Israeli soldier near the Zammo roundabout, east of Jabalia, in northern Gaza.
